Helen’s role at The Dawn
As Clinical Director, Helen keeps the clinical programme aligned with The Dawn’s philosophy of Trauma Informed Care, and she oversees a multidisciplinary team of psychologists and psychotherapists. What sets her role apart is that she personally reviews each client’s treatment plan with both the client and their focal therapist. That review is where a standard programme becomes an individual one: it is the point at which Helen checks that the plan fits the person in front of her, rather than asking the person to fit the plan. Before becoming Clinical Director, Helen worked at The Dawn as a Trauma, Mental Health and Addiction psychotherapist. Her approach brings mental health, addiction recovery and trauma treatment together, because for many of the people she works with, these challenges are connected, parts of the same story.Expertise and professional standing

Helen Well’s Qualifications and accreditations
Helen holds a Bachelor of Applied Social Science (Counselling) from the Australian College of Applied Psychology and a Post Graduate Diploma in Couples and Family Therapy from Relationships Australia. Alongside her degrees, she holds a number of clinical accreditations that shape her work with trauma and crisis:
- Certified clinical trauma professional, trained in trauma informed care
- Accredited Mental Health First Aid practitioner and accredited Lifeline crisis support worker
- Specialised training in domestic and family violence support, and accreditation in the Interventions for Children with Trauma and Anxiety programme
